In the Krasnoyarsk Territory, they have not been able to find a hunter who went missing in the north for a week


8 November 14:39

In the Evenki region, police began searching for a 36-year-old hunter who disappeared at the end of October.

Law enforcement officers received a report about the missing man on the evening of November 3, and his wife turned to law enforcement officers for help. The woman said that on October 2, her husband went hunting. The man planned to return home on October 31, but did not do so.

When the hunter stopped communicating, concerned relatives rushed to search for him on their own. But this did not bring any results.

After the wife of the missing man contacted the police, law enforcement officers, together with experienced volunteers on snowmobiles, examined the forest area, the banks of the Bergima and Chunya rivers, the channels of the Podkamennaya Tunguska River and hunting huts. Also, using underwater cameras, a part of the Chunya River was examined.

“Due to bad weather conditions, at the moment it is not possible to involve aviation equipment in search activities to examine the place where the hunter went missing,” explained the Main Directorate of the Ministry of Internal Affairs of Russia for the region.
